Depending on the mode of operation used, the counter is cleared, incremented, or dec-  
remented at each timer clock (clkT2). clkT2 can be generated from an external or internal  
clock source, selected by the Clock Select bits (CS22:0). When no clock source is  
selected (CS22:0 = 0) the timer is stopped. However, the TCNT2 value can be accessed  
by the CPU, regardless of whether clkT2 is present or not. A CPU write overrides (has  
priority over) all counter clear or count operations.  
The counting sequence is determined by the setting of the WGM21 and WGM20 bits  
located in the Timer/Counter Control Register (TCCR2). There are close connections  
between how the counter behaves (counts) and how waveforms are generated on the  
Output Compare output OC2. For more details about advanced counting sequences  
and waveform generation, see “Modes of Operation” on page 115.  
The Timer/Counter Overflow (TOV2) flag is set according to the mode of operation  
selected by the WGM21:0 bits. TOV2 can be used for generating a CPU interrupt.  
Output Compare Unit  
The 8-bit comparator continuously compares TCNT2 with the output compare register  
(OCR2). Whenever TCNT2 equals OCR2, the comparator signals a match. A match will  
set the Output Compare Flag (OCF2) at the next timer clock cycle. If enabled (OCIE2 =  
1), the output compare flag generates an output compare interrupt. The OCF2 flag is  
automatically cleared when the interrupt is executed. Alternatively, the OCF2 flag can  
be cleared by software by writing a logical one to its I/O bit location. The waveform gen-  
erator uses the match signal to generate an output according to operating mode set by  
the WGM21:0 bits and Compare Output mode (COM21:0) bits. The max and bottom sig-  
nals are used by the waveform generator for handling the special cases of the extreme  
values in some modes of operation (“Modes of Operation” on page 115). Figure 55  
shows a block diagram of the output compare unit.
